## Values

- Hex: `#741b52`
- RGB: rgb(116, 27, 82)
- HSL: hsl(323, 62%, 28%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.389 0.135 347.3)
- Relative luminance: 0.0511

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 10.39: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
- On black (#000000): 2.02: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#d03594 (4.62:1); AA: background → #ababab (4.52:1); AAA: text → #de73b5 (7.23:1); AAA: background → #d4d4d4 (7.01:1)
